Quellcode-Paket alsa-oss herunterladen:
Dieses Paket enthält einen Programmlader, aoss, der Anwendungen, die für OSS geschrieben sind, in eine Kompatibilitätsbibliothek einhüllt. So ermöglicht er ihnen, mit ALSA zu arbeiten.
Es gibt zwei Methoden, wie man eine Anwendung, die für OSS geschrieben wurde, dazu bringen kann, mit ALSA zusammenzuarbeiten. Der erste Weg ist, die speziellen ALSA Treiber zu laden, die das OSS Kernel-Interface emulieren; diese ermöglichen es Anwendungen, /dev/dsp0 und andere OSS-Gerätedateien zu öffnen. Der zweite Weg ist, die Anwendung in die libaoss-Bibliothek zu hüllen, die von diesem Paket zur Verfügung gestellt wird; die Hülle bringt die Anwendung dazu, native ALSA Gerätedateien wie /dev/snd/pcmC0D0c zu öffnen statt der OSS Gerätedateien.
Der Gebrauch der alsa-oss-Bibliothek statt der OSS-Emulations-Treiber wird empfohlen, wenn man ALSAs PCM-Plugin-Layer verwenden möchte.
ALSA steht für Advanced Linux Sound Architecture:
http://alsa.sourceforge.net
OSS ist die freie Version des Open Sound Systems.
|
|
|
| Architektur | Paketgröße | Größe (installiert) | Dateien |
|---|---|---|---|
| alpha | 68,9 kB | 320 kB | [Liste der Dateien] |
| amd64 | 53,7 kB | 256 kB | [Liste der Dateien] |
| arm | 48,1 kB | 142 kB | [Liste der Dateien] |
| armel | 48,3 kB | 216 kB | [Liste der Dateien] |
| hppa | 63,1 kB | 252 kB | [Liste der Dateien] |
| i386 | 50,8 kB | 168 kB | [Liste der Dateien] |
| ia64 | 78,3 kB | 364 kB | [Liste der Dateien] |
| mips | 56,0 kB | 252 kB | [Liste der Dateien] |
| mipsel | 55,8 kB | 252 kB | [Liste der Dateien] |
| powerpc | 61,0 kB | 248 kB | [Liste der Dateien] |
| s390 | 57,2 kB | 232 kB | [Liste der Dateien] |
| sparc | 48,9 kB | 236 kB | [Liste der Dateien] |